Step 1
With gloves on and a sharp knife, cut the stem off the hot peppers and cut pepper in half. Put the peppers and seeds into Pressure Cooker cooking pot
Step 2
Cut and core the sweet red pepper and add to the cooking pot.
Step 3
Add in the rest of the ingredients.
Step 4
Lock on Lid and close Pressure Valve.
Step 5
Cook at High Pressure for 1 minute.
Step 6
When Beep sounds, allow a Full Natural Pressure Release. DO NOT DO A QUICK RELEASE!
Step 7
Carefully open lid and do not breath in steam.
Step 8
Pour contents into your Vitamix and process until well pureed.
Step 9
Store in Hot Sauce Bottles.
